Huaiyong Li is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, Huaiyong Li has authored 75 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 59 papers in Materials Chemistry, 33 papers in Electrical and Electronic Engineering and 13 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in Huaiyong Li’s work include Luminescence Properties of Advanced Materials (29 papers), Advanced Photocatalysis Techniques (13 papers) and Ferroelectric and Piezoelectric Materials (12 papers). Huaiyong Li is often cited by papers focused on Luminescence Properties of Advanced Materials (29 papers), Advanced Photocatalysis Techniques (13 papers) and Ferroelectric and Piezoelectric Materials (12 papers). Huaiyong Li collaborates with scholars based in China, South Korea and Taiwan. Huaiyong Li's co-authors include Shihong Zhou, Siyuan Zhang, Jung Hyun Jeong, Xin Shao, Soung Soo Yi, Kiwan Jang, Ho Sueb Lee, Hyun Kyoung Yang, Byung Kee Moon and Byung Chun Choi and has published in prestigious journals such as Applied Physics Letters, The Journal of Physical Chemistry B and Journal of The Electrochemical Society.
